What are the different kinds of primary care providers, including Pediatricians, near Kennett Square, PA?
- A pediatrician is an expert in childhood growth and development and they are frequently the primary care provider for children under 18.
- Adults near Kennett Square, PA generally see an Internist, a General Practitioner, or a Family Practitioner (often informally called a Family Doctor) for their primary care.
- Older adults near Kennett Square, PA may see a Geriatrician, which is a provider that specializes in the care of older people.
- Some women near Kennett Square, PA choose to receive their primary care from their OB/GYN (obstetrician/gynecologist), though if you have multiple medical issues, it may be in your best interest to find a primary care physician.

What should I bring with me to an appointment with my Pediatrician near Kennett Square, PA?
Bring your list of concerns (or reasons for your visit) with you on a piece of paper or your phone, so you can easily recall them when speaking to your Pediatrician in Kennett Square. You may want to consider bringing a friend or loved one for support, and to help you recall the information after your Pediatrician visit. Bring a notebook so you can take notes, copies of your medical records (dating back at least one year), a list of current medications, supplements and allergies to medications, your family history of disease, and a list of symptoms (and details about how long they last and how often they occur) to discuss with your Kennett Square Pediatrician.

How far should I travel to find the best Pediatrician near Kennett Square, PA?
Despite our increasingly connected world, there are times when you need to see your Pediatrician in person in Kennett Square. For Pediatricians, this study concluded that people typically only travel about 18 minutes. So, a good rule of thumb is to select a primary care physician that is located near you in Kennett Square, somewhere between 15-30 minutes away. For more specialized care, you may need to travel considerably further, but look for specialists within 45 minutes of your home near Kennett Square, PA if possible.
In recent years, many Pediatricians have also adopted telehealth, also commonly called telemedicine, which is the use of digital technology to provide or supplement patient care. Telehealth can help reduce the burden of physical travel to your Pediatrician near Kennett Square, PA. You might wish to consider contacting your Pediatrician’s office to learn about the telehealth options they offer for Kennett Square, as well as your insurance provider.
